Our latest radio love is a little scrappier than usual. The online-only Plaza Midwood Community Radio is the city's new hyperlocal neighborhood radio station; it offers a free-form mix of DIY shows, the best of which is Armando Bellmas' Ecléctico. As Bellmas points out in his warm, soothing voice at the top of each show, his mission is to "lovingly blend English and Spanish music and culture." That means he may read a poem by Roberto Bolaño or have John Giorno read one of his own, then mix it into a playlist that moves seamlessly from My Morning Jacket's "The Bear" to Nina Simone's "Pirate Jenny," from "Búfalos" by the Chilean band Los Mil Jinetes to "Tengo Frío" by Mexico's Ely Guerra, then back to sweet home Carolina with Whiskeytown's "Midway Park."
